What Affects Solar Panel Installation & Repair Costs in South Houston?
Understanding pricing factors helps you budget accurately and avoid surprises
labor costs
Labor rates in South Houston reflect the competitive Harris County market for skilled solar technicians. Certified installers (like NABCEP pros) typically charge more for their expertise, especially with high demand for quality work. Crew size and experience also play a role.
market dynamics
Texas' sunny climate and rising energy costs drive strong demand for solar services. Supply of qualified installers is growing, but competition from Houston's metro area keeps rates balanced – though shortages can nudge prices up. Equipment availability via local suppliers affects overall costs.
seasonal trends
Peak demand hits in spring and fall when homeowners plan energy upgrades before summer AC bills spike. Hot summers may slow installs due to heat, while mild winters offer better rates and scheduling.
🧱 Key Pricing Components
- ✓ System size & capacity - Matches your home's energy needs; larger systems cost more.
- ✓ Roof type & accessibility - Steep pitches or poor condition add labor hours.
- ✓ Panel & inverter quality - Higher-efficiency Tier 1 brands increase upfront costs but save long-term.
- ✓ Permitting & inspections - Harris County fees and utility approvals.
- ✓ Wiring, mounting & extras - Batteries or monitoring systems add to the total.

How to Save Money on Solar Panel Installation & Repair
Smart strategies to get quality service without overpaying
Tip
Get 3+ itemized quotes from licensed, insured local solar experts.
Tip
Ask for NABCEP certification and details on equipment warranties (25+ years standard).
Tip
Discuss incentives like federal tax credits and any Texas rebates upfront.
Tip
Provide your annual kWh usage and roof specs for accurate apples-to-apples bids.
Tip
Verify references and check reviews on platforms like EnergySage or BBB.
Pricing Red Flags
Warning Sign
Unrealistically low quotes – quality solar isn't 'bargain basement'; hidden corners get cut.
Warning Sign
Pressure tactics like 'sign today for discount' – good pros give time to decide.
Warning Sign
No written breakdown or vague on permits, warranties, or materials.
Warning Sign
Upfront large deposits over 10-20% without contract.
Warning Sign
Door-to-door sales without local credentials or licenses.

💬 Are there incentives to lower solar costs in South Houston?
Yes, federal ITC covers 30% through 2032, plus net metering via local utilities.
Texas offers no statewide rebate but check CenterPoint Energy programs.
Pros can run your numbers for max savings.
💬 Does roof condition affect pricing?
Absolutely – poor roofs need repairs first, adding $5k+ potentially.
Steep or shaded roofs hike labor; flat/complex ones too.
Many installers assess free.
💬 How to compare quotes fairly?
Insist on itemized bids covering labor, materials, permits.
Use your kWh needs and address for tailored estimates.
Ignore 'per panel' pricing; focus on total system performance.
💬 What warranties should I expect?
Top installs offer 25-year panel production warranties, 10-12 years on inverters.
Labor warranties 5-10 years; get all in writing.
Ask about workmanship guarantees.
